The Israelites Collecting Manna from Heaven

The Israelites Collecting Manna from Heaven; Master of James IV of Scotland, Flemish, before 1465 - about 1541; Bruges, Belgium, Europe; about 1510 - 1520; Tempera colors, gold, and ink on parchment; Leaf: 23.2 x 16.7 cm (9 1/8 x 6 9/16 in.), Justification: 10.9 x 7.4 cm (4 5/16 x 2 15/16 in.)

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ases a remarkable artwork titled "The Israelites Collecting Manna from Heaven" by the Master of James IV of Scotland. Created in Bruges, Belgium, between 1510 and 1520, this masterpiece is a testament to the artist's skill and attention to detail. In this scene, we witness the biblical event where the Israelites gather manna from heaven. The artist's use of tempera colors, gold accents, and ink on parchment brings vibrancy and depth to each element depicted. The leaf measures 23.2 x 16.7 cm (9 1/8 x 6 9/16 in. ), with a smaller justification area measuring at 10.9 x 7.4 cm (4 5/16 x 2 15/16 in. ). The composition transports us back in time as we observe the Israelites diligently collecting nourishment provided by God himself during their journey through the desert. It serves as a reminder of divine intervention and sustenance during times of hardship.
